70000TONS OF METAL Announces Public Sales Date for 2026 Voyage and Welcomes Thrash Legends Anthrax to the Lineup

  70000TONS OF METAL, The Original, The World’s Biggest Heavy Metal Cruise, proudly announces that Public Sales for the 2026 sailing will begin on Tuesday, August 19, 2025 at 12:00 PM EDT / 18:00 CET via 70000tons.com. The festival-at-sea continues its tradition of delivering an unforgettable experience with 60 metal bands from around the globe, playing across four stages – including the legendary Pool Deck Stage, The World's Biggest Open Air Stage Structure to Ever Sail the Open Seas. In addition to unveiling the Public Sales date, 70000TONS OF METAL is thrilled to confirm the addition of thrash metal icons ANTHRAX to the 2026 lineup. 70000TONS OF METAL ANNOUNCES DESTINATION CHANGE + INITIAL LINEUP FOR 2026 SAILING

  70000TONS OF METAL, The Original, The World’s Biggest Heavy Metal Cruise, has announced a change in the destination for its 2026 voyage. The upcoming edition of the festival at sea, taking place from January 29 to February 2, 2026, will now sail from Miami, Florida to Nassau, The Bahamas aboard Royal Caribbean’s Freedom of the Seas. Originally planned to return to Labadee, Haiti, the decision to reroute the journey was made out of an abundance of caution and with the well-being of all Sailors, artists, and crew as the top priority. "While Labadee has been a great port of call on past sailings, we are closely monitoring the evolving situation in Haiti and its surrounding regions," said Andy Piller, Skipper of 70000TONS OF METAL. "Ensuring the safety and comfort of our Survivors is non-negotiable. With that in mind, we’ve made the proactive decision to change course for 2026.
